宇澜旭

COD16 CE内存修改,从原理到风险的深度解析

本文深度解析了利用CE修改COD16内存的原理与风险,内容详细探讨了内存寻址、指针链追踪等底层技术,同时重点分析了VAC及BattlEye反作弊系统的检测机制与封号后果,文章旨在揭示作弊技术逻辑,并警示玩家远离外挂,以保障账号安全。

在《使命召唤16:现代战争》(Call of Duty: Modern Warfare,简称COD16)的玩家群体中,关于使用Cheat Engine(CE)修改游戏数据的讨论从未停止,许多单机玩家希望通过CE来实现“无限弹药”、“无敌模式”或者修改游戏参数,以获得不同于常规流程的体验,由于COD16特殊的游戏架构和严格的反作弊机制,盲目使用CE往往伴随着巨大的风险,本文将深入探讨在COD16中使用CE的可行性、操作难点以及必须注意的风险。

多人模式与战役模式的本质区别

COD16 CE内存修改,从原理到风险的深度解析

必须明确一个核心原则:CE绝不能用于COD16的多人对战模式。

COD16的多人模式配备了动视强大的反作弊系统——Ricochet,该系统不仅检测游戏内的异常数据,还会扫描后台进程,一旦检测到CE等内存修改工具正在尝试挂钩游戏进程,玩家的账号极大概率会面临永久封禁,对于多人模式,公平性是游戏的基石,任何试图通过CE获取不正当优势的行为都是不可取的,且后果极其严重。

关于“COD16用CE”的讨论,仅限于战役模式特种作战模式

战役模式中使用CE的技术难点

在早期的单机游戏中,使用CE修改数值(如生命值、子弹数)非常简单,通常通过首次扫描、再次数值变更就能锁定内存地址,但在COD16中,这一过程变得异常复杂,主要原因有以下几点:

  1. 数据加密与偏移: COD16的内存管理机制非常先进,玩家看到的数值(如血条)在内存中并非以明文存储,或者经过了多层指针的索引,直接搜索数值往往一无所获。
  2. 动态内存分配: 游戏每次重启或进入新关卡,内存地址都会发生改变,这意味着你需要找到稳定的“基址”和“偏移量”,通过指针链来定位数据,而非直接修改静态地址。
  3. 反调试干扰: 即使在战役模式中,游戏依然保留了一定的自我保护机制,可能会干扰CE的调试功能,导致游戏崩溃或修改失效。

如何相对安全地在战役模式尝试(仅供技术研究)

如果你是一名资深玩家,仅仅想在通关后通过CE“魔改”战役模式体验剧情,建议遵循以下安全守则:

  1. 彻底断网: 在启动游戏和CE之前,务必断开网络连接(拔掉网线或禁用网卡),这可以防止游戏数据上传云端触发反作弊检测,也能避免误入多人模式。
  2. 寻找CT表: 由于自行寻找COD16的内存基址难度极大,大多数普通玩家会选择使用由国外大神制作好的“.CT”文件(Cheat Table),这些文件包含了预先写好的脚本和地址偏移,能够一键开启“上帝模式”或“无限弹药”。
  3. 关注版本匹配: 游戏更新往往会改变内存结构,导致旧的CT表失效,使用时必须确认CT表版本与你的游戏版本一致。

总结与警示

“COD16用CE”在技术上是一个高门槛的操作,在规则上是一个高风险的行为,对于普通玩家,最安全的方式是享受游戏原本的设计,如果你坚持要在战役模式中使用,请务必保持克制,仅在离线状态下进行,并时刻牢记:不要让CE在你的多人游戏启动时运行。

游戏是为了快乐,而封号则得不偿失,希望每一位玩家都能在遵守规则的前提下,享受《使命召唤16》带来的视听盛宴。

bylx
bylx
这个人很神秘